gpt4 book ai didi

VBA 在知道部分名称的情况下从此工作簿的文件夹中打开文件

转载 作者:行者123 更新时间:2023-12-04 21:15:02 25 4
gpt4 key购买 nike

我正在尝试从与主工作簿相同的文件夹中打开文件。问题是这个名字不是永久的,只有一个词总是留在名字里——“NAME”。

我想对 Thisworkbook.Path 使用特定的方法打开 xlsx 文件,但找不到带有代码的工作簿。

这是代码的相关部分:

Sub RemoveDuplicats()

Dim Harel As Workbook
Dim SAP As Workbook
Dim Path As String
Dim Found As String

Path = ThisWorkbook.Path
Found = Dir(Path & "*NAME*.xlsx") 'open SAP report
If Found <> "" Then
Set SAP = Workbooks.Open(Path & Found)
End If

End Sub

最佳答案

ThisWorkbook.Path 返回不带反斜杠的路径,
尝试

Found = Dir ( Path & "\" & "*NAME*.xlsx")

关于VBA 在知道部分名称的情况下从此工作簿的文件夹中打开文件,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/47768263/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com